From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Brian Jun (born October 21, 1979) is an American film director, screenwriter, film editor and producer. Jun has made two short films, Jimmy Brown and Researching Raymond Burke. Jun won the Sundance Channel Emerging Director Award in 2006 at the St. Louis Film Festival for his first feature film Steel City. The film also received a nomination for the grand prize jury award at the Sundance Film Festival in 2006. As of June 2008, his second feature film The Thacker Case is in post-production.
